Transaction 90e27d76543e8baef38895e76f64961cf25d3c1a62a57314070eb0caae34cd46
1 Input
3 Outputs
- 90e27d76543e8baef38895e76f64961cf25d3c1a62a57314070eb0caae34cd46:0
- 90e27d76543e8baef38895e76f64961cf25d3c1a62a57314070eb0caae34cd46:1
- 90e27d76543e8baef38895e76f64961cf25d3c1a62a57314070eb0caae34cd46:2
value 15389116311
address 1H4o9Mh7HyjPa46z4vtv7J8yzaK5RY4bXR
value 39091460
address 39Z9zNtL15nHTJxgjfKzwW3u5Z3hBX5ECJ
value 59000000
address 1Egg1ewfodhPpzxT54Cd67i3xLSaE3mFQ5